A mixed bag, and it might be worth taking a chance on GWAN SO, who stepped up markedly on his debut effort when second at Naas, and was nicely clear of the rest that day. Mount Fairweather and Pride of Derry have been progressive so far and could play leading roles, too.

  1. GWAN SO
  2. MOUNT FAIRWEATHER
  3. PRIDE OF DERRY
